Пятничное чтиво
Привет!
На следующей неделе будет стрим, продолжим разбираться с эвент сорсингом. Расскажу о концепции streams и о read/write моделях. Начало 10 апреля, среда, в 20:00 по москве.
Календарь
Youtube плейлист всех стримов
—————————————
Moving on from Rails and what’s next
Начнем с грустных новостей. Еще один рейс кор разработчик уходит из руби. На этот раз в rust и diesel (ORM для раста). Причина: Sean заметил, что работает над rust и crates io большую часть времени. Можно поддержать разработчика на патреоне.
—————————————
Why language-oriented programming? Why Racket?
LISP языки - моя тайная страсть. Люблю scheme (даже делал интерпретатор на руби), command lisp и racket. О последнем статья выше. Автор ответит на вопрос зачем создание собственных предметно-ориентированных языков нужно и почему написание таких языков на racket логично. А также приведёт примеры, где используются предметные языки и для каких задач это оправдано
Русский перевод
—————————————
How we Built a Highly Performant App with Ruby on Rails and Phoenix
Статья описывающая как подружить рельсовое и феникс приложение. Секрет успеха: Exq (sidekiq совместимый бэкграунд процессинг) и sidekiq с redis для отложенных задач. А также общая база данных и request forwarding.
Подход интересный. Хочется почитать сколько времени занял переход на такую архитектуру, какие проблемы возникли, как такую систему дебажат и разрабатывают фичи, завязанные на оба приложения.
—————————————
БОНУС: Ruby’s Creed
В качестве бонуса мысли Божидара (автора rubocop) о языке, экосистеме и будущем ruby. Автор попросил воспринимать пост как начало диалога, поэтому, если есть что сказать - комментарии открыты или приходите первого июня на spbrubyconf где Божидар расскажет о ruby 3.0.
Привет!
На следующей неделе будет стрим, продолжим разбираться с эвент сорсингом. Расскажу о концепции streams и о read/write моделях. Начало 10 апреля, среда, в 20:00 по москве.
Календарь
Youtube плейлист всех стримов
—————————————
Moving on from Rails and what’s next
Начнем с грустных новостей. Еще один рейс кор разработчик уходит из руби. На этот раз в rust и diesel (ORM для раста). Причина: Sean заметил, что работает над rust и crates io большую часть времени. Можно поддержать разработчика на патреоне.
—————————————
Why language-oriented programming? Why Racket?
LISP языки - моя тайная страсть. Люблю scheme (даже делал интерпретатор на руби), command lisp и racket. О последнем статья выше. Автор ответит на вопрос зачем создание собственных предметно-ориентированных языков нужно и почему написание таких языков на racket логично. А также приведёт примеры, где используются предметные языки и для каких задач это оправдано
Русский перевод
—————————————
How we Built a Highly Performant App with Ruby on Rails and Phoenix
Статья описывающая как подружить рельсовое и феникс приложение. Секрет успеха: Exq (sidekiq совместимый бэкграунд процессинг) и sidekiq с redis для отложенных задач. А также общая база данных и request forwarding.
Подход интересный. Хочется почитать сколько времени занял переход на такую архитектуру, какие проблемы возникли, как такую систему дебажат и разрабатывают фичи, завязанные на оба приложения.
—————————————
БОНУС: Ruby’s Creed
В качестве бонуса мысли Божидара (автора rubocop) о языке, экосистеме и будущем ruby. Автор попросил воспринимать пост как начало диалога, поэтому, если есть что сказать - комментарии открыты или приходите первого июня на spbrubyconf где Божидар расскажет о ruby 3.0.